Property Manager

The Property Manager leads all aspects of a single asset or portfolio of commercial, industrial, and / or retail properties and coordinates all marketing, operations, and financial activities per client and / or company requirements.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ities :

  • Ensure that services are provided consistent with policies, procedures, and regulations as well as contractual obligations and standards.
  • Coordinate and lead daily and long-term activities of the team; establish work schedules, assign tasks, and cross-train staff; establish and track deadlines to meet client and company objectives; elevate team performance through subject matter expertise and suggestions to improve systems, processes, and procedures; provide formal coaching, mentoring, supervision, and guidance; recruit and hire new team members; monitor training and development of staff; develop and deliver performance reviews.
  • Direct, review, and approve vendor invoice payments and other accounting related activities following the terms of the management agreement, LPC policies, and property management approval authorization limits.
  • Direct and control preparation, and delivery, of timely, accurate, and insightful monthly reports as well as annual operating and capital budgets; prepare and submit tenant rent and Common Area Maintenance (CAM) or Escalation (OpX) recovery charges to client.
  • Maintain oversight of contracted terms that impact the financial performance of the asset / company; report on expirations, covenants, restrictions, and other encumbrances that drive decision making and asset value.
  • Coordinate all lease administration activities with lease administrator and accounting; review all lease set ups, lease changes, reporting, etc. and provide final approval.
  • Coordinate tenant move-ins and move-outs, and "walk-through" spaces with tenants and tenant improvement department; maintain vacant spaces in "tour ready" condition; ensure teams assigned to tenant onboarding activities properly document and communicate with tenants timely and appropriately; follow up with tenants to ensure a successful transition.
  • Respond to tenant needs, ensuring that administrative and building technical staff resolve problems promptly; craft, deliver, and communicate an effective tenant care program that maximizes tenant retention.
  • Direct sourcing and procurement activities to effect optimal operations; deliver detailed bid analysis and recommendations to clients that drive value; manage quality of vendor service delivery to ensure contract compliance and desired value.
  • Proactively collect rent and other charges in accordance with lease terms and report status of AR to client(s) with recommendations for action; prepare client approved standard legal notices.
  • Ensure that at least monthly property inspections are performed; recommend and / or approve alterations, maintenance, and reconditioning.; contract for, and coordinate, vendors.
  • Document plans and preparations for emergency response; ensure resources, supplies, and backups are in place to effectively recover from adverse events; coordinate drills and other required training.
  • Act as primary contact with property owners, serving as Owner Representative to ensure objectives are being met.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
